WebMapReduce is a processing technique and a program model for distributed computing based on java. The MapReduce algorithm contains two important tasks, namely Map and Reduce. Map takes a set of data and converts it into another set of data, where individual elements are broken down into tuples (key/value pairs). We just need to put the business logic … WebOct 28, 2016 · MapReduce-based systems have emerged as a prominent framework for large-scale data analysis, having fault tolerance as one of its key features. MapReduce has introduced simple yet efficient mechanisms to handle different kinds of failures including crashes, omissions, and arbitrary failures.
